    Sherwin C.

    A delicious spot that gets all the little details right, this is an ideal place to host a special event or to have a special meal. The decor is elegant, with a more modern feel among the furniture yet fun lantern accents on the ceiling and a very cool bar with a lots of colors from the bottles and lights. The plating and silverware follow this more upscale feel as well though the prices aren't too high for the awesome presentation that you get with your food (exceeding sometimes even what you're getting on nicer cruises) and speedy service. I also like the menu variety with lots of different options to fit a variety of cravings from hummus to carpaccio to burgers to pastas to steaks to roasted meats. This really suits any mixed group well as everyone can enjoy a distinctly different meal. The food here is definitely the star. Again, the presentation really shines here as everything is plated in a very organized manner that really gives each meal a more premium feel. Fortunately, the flavors here are just as good -- with extra points for the quality of all the non-meat options. Everything from the homemade hummus to eggplant chutney to cucumber salad to tzatziki sauce to crispy potatoes are super flavorful and seasoned just right. Most importantly, the vegetables are clearly fresh and flavor really comes through well -- pairing perfectly with their delicious pita bread. But don't underestimate the tender slow roasted lamb or delicious pasta options here either. They are prepared with just as much care and a well balanced flavor. Desserts such as the chocolate cake also follow this theme -- nicely plated, full of flavor, and a small element that helps to elevate the flavor of the main item. Overall, an excellent spot to enjoy a delicious meal. The presentation alone is well worth bringing someone to have a meal here and having the deliciousness of the food to match this presentation is a plus. If you also like the fresh and healthy flavor of Mediterranean food, this is definitely a top option for you.

    This place looks like a scaled-down Hampton Social, conspicuously the "ivy" panels suspended from the ceiling. An elegantly backlit bar is the focal point of the dining room. The extensive beverage menu and a long list of shareable apps draw in a young professional crowd. Tables are mostly 2-tops which can be easily rearranged into 4-tops or larger. Food is uniquely Bulgarian-ish Mediterranean. We went here for dinner on Valentine's Day. Our bad because it's generally not fair to base a restaurant review on an initial visit during a busy Holiday, when things are more likely to go awry. Since an owner did try to make amends, I'm giving them 3 stars instead of 2. My Missus and I decided to forgo the apps and focus on main courses. Unfortunately we waited for nearly ONE HOUR before so much as a morsel of food arrived at our table. And then our server delivered only one of our two entrées - her cedar plank salmon. Mine? He replied hurriedly, "The other dish is coming!" But an additional 12 minutes elapsed before my duck breast fillet finally arrived. Meanwhile, we expressed our displeasure to a co-owner, who apologized and offered us dessert on the house. The food, high-quality and well-prepared, was quite good. But our entrées did not wow us. Portions were adequate but not generous. Perhaps we would have done better to follow the example of other diners who were sipping cocktails and feasting on hefty app platters (which did not require long prep times) in lieu of cooked entrées. By the time we ordered dessert - lemon sponge cake - the room was no longer busy. But we endured yet another inexplicable wait. For cripes sake, it does not take 15 minutes to plate two slices of cake! Moreover our server neglected to bring forks, so again we had to flag down the co-owner. A leisurely pace appears to be the norm here. But an absurdly glacial pace with stumbling service is not acceptable.

    Talk about a hidden gem. This place is tucked into a shopping center and you have to be looking for it in order to find it. But you will be glad that you made the effort to find Social Inn because my husband and I had a great experience there. We started off our meal with the Social Spreads (homemade hummus, roasted red pepper and eggplant chutney, creamed Feta and yogurt mixed with Persian cucumbers, house baked pita bread). The dips were phenomenal. My favorite was the roasted red pepper spread. It was sweet and deep in flavor. For entrees I had the Slow Roasted Lamb (roasted to juicy perfection, paired with crispy wedge potatoes, soft pita bread, house-made tzatziki and tomato and cucumber salad), while my husband had the Rigatoni with Sausage (large tubular pasta with homemade sausage and peas, light tomato cream cheese). Both of these dishes were large and seasoned well. You could really taste the lamb flavor that the slow cooking brought out! To finish our meal, we had the classic chocolate cake. It was smaller than expected but the taste was huge! Our server was very nice and friendly. We had a great time and can't wait to come back and try more of their menu. I highly recommend Social Inn!
